#a55064 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#a55064 is composed of 64.7% red, 31.4% green and 39.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 51.5% magenta, 39.4% yellow and 35.3% black. It has a hue angle of 345.9 degrees, a saturation of 34.7% and a lightness of 48%. #a55064 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ffa0c8 with #4b0000. Closest websafe color is: #996666.

Shades and Tints of #a55064

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060304 is the darkest color, while #fcf8f9 is the lightest one.
